The Dubuque Law Enforcement Center is changing its open-lobby policy to deter homeless individuals from sleeping there. According to a press release, the inner lobby doors of the building will now be locked from 4:30 p.m. to 8 a.m., and the outer lobby doors adjacent to the sidewalk will be locked from 6 p.m. to 8 a.m. To access the center after regular business hours, individuals can now use a call button and dispatch will unlock the doors. The decision to lock the doors is in response to individuals congregating in the lobby area and leaving trash and belongings behind.
